=== 2015–present === [[File:20190911SM235 (48722585617).jpg|thumb|248x248px|Harris at the [[National Book Festival]] in 2019]]On February 22, 2015, he hosted the [[87th Academy Awards]].<ref>{{cite web|author=<!--Staff writer(s); no by-line.-->|url=http://mobi.iafrica.com/movies/2015/02/23/neil-patrick-harris-wows-as-oscars-host|title=Neil Patrick Harris wows as Oscars host|publisher=Mobi.iafrica.com|access-date=February 23, 2015|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20150223144809/http://mobi.iafrica.com/movies/2015/02/23/neil-patrick-harris-wows-as-oscars-host/|archive-date=February 23, 2015|url-status=dead}}</ref><ref>{{cite news |last1=Gray |first1=Tim |date=October 15, 2014 |title=Neil Patrick Harris to Host the Oscars |url=https://variety.com/2014/film/news/neil-patrick-harris-to-host-the-oscars-exclusive-1201312943/ |url-status=live |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20141015212811/http://variety.com/2014/film/news/neil-patrick-harris-to-host-the-oscars-exclusive-1201312943/ |archive-date=October 15, 2014 |access-date=October 15, 2014 |work=[[Variety (magazine)|Variety]]|publisher=[[Penske Media Corporation]]}}</ref> On September 15, 2015, ''[[Best Time Ever with Neil Patrick Harris]]'', a [[variety series]] hosted and executive produced by Harris, premiered [[Live television|live]] on [[NBC]] and ran for eight episodes.<ref>{{cite web |date=December 16, 2015 |title=Best Time Ever With Neil Patrick Harris: Cancelled by NBC; No Season Two |url=http://tvseriesfinale.com/tv-show/best-time-ever-with-neil-patrick-harris-cancelled-by-nbc-no-season-two/ |url-status=live |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20210131215033/https://tvseriesfinale.com/tv-show/best-time-ever-with-neil-patrick-harris-cancelled-by-nbc-no-season-two/ |archive-date=January 31, 2021 |access-date=December 16, 2015 |website=TV Series Finale}}</ref> He declined to appear in the [[American Horror Story: Hotel|fifth season]] of ''[[American Horror Story]]'' after appearing in [[American Horror Story: Freak Show|the fourth]] in a guest role due to scheduling conflicts with ''Best Time Ever''.<ref>{{cite web|url=https://www.vanityfair.com/hollywood/2015/09/neil-patrick-harris-american-horror-story-hotel|title=Why Neil Patrick Harris Is Skipping Out on American Horror Story This Season|last=Robinson|first=Joanna|work=[[Vanity Fair (magazine)|Vanity Fair]]|date=September 22, 2015|access-date=May 20, 2025|archive-date=July 7, 2022|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20220707104621/https://www.vanityfair.com/hollywood/2015/09/neil-patrick-harris-american-horror-story-hotel|url-status=live}}</ref> On January 15, 2016, Harris was cast as [[Count Olaf]] in [[A Series of Unfortunate Events (TV series)|the television adaptation]] of ''[[A Series of Unfortunate Events]]''.<ref>{{cite web |last1=Kit |first1=Borys |last2=Goldberg |first2=Lesley |date=January 15, 2016 |title=Neil Patrick Harris to Star in Netflix's 'A Series of Unfortunate Events' as Showrunner Exits |url=https://www.hollywoodreporter.com/live-feed/neil-patrick-harris-star-netflixs-855209 |url-status=live |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20190517044933/https://www.hollywoodreporter.com/live-feed/neil-patrick-harris-star-netflixs-855209 |archive-date=May 17, 2019 |access-date=January 21, 2016 |work=[[The Hollywood Reporter]]}}</ref> It ran for 3 seasons and 25 episodes on the streaming service [[Netflix]] before ending on January 1, 2019.<ref name="Season3Date">{{cite web |last=Maas |first=Jennifer |url=https://www.thewrap.com/series-unfortunate-events-final-season-3-premiere-date-video/ |title='Series of Unfortunate Events': Count Olaf, Lemony Snicket Set Final Season Premiere Date – Unfortunately (Video) |work=[[TheWrap]] |date=November 13, 2018 |access-date=November 13, 2018 |archive-date=November 14, 2018 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20181114013258/https://www.thewrap.com/series-unfortunate-events-final-season-3-premiere-date-video/ |url-status=live }}</ref> On March 31, 2017, NBC picked up the game show ''[[Genius Junior]]'' with Harris as host and executive producer. The format would test teams of children, aged 12 and under, in various subjects including spelling, mathematics, and memory. The series received a 10-episode order and debuted on March 18, 2018.<ref>{{cite web |last1=Stanhope |first1=Kate |last2=Goldberg |first2=Lesley |date=March 31, 2017 |title=NBC Greenlights 'Genius Junior' Game Show Hosted by Neil Patrick Harris |url=https://www.hollywoodreporter.com/live-feed/nbc-greenlights-genius-junior-game-show-hosted-by-neil-patrick-harris-990454 |url-status=live |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170331225224/http://www.hollywoodreporter.com/live-feed/nbc-greenlights-genius-junior-game-show-hosted-by-neil-patrick-harris-990454 |archive-date=March 31, 2017 |access-date=April 1, 2017 |work=[[The Hollywood Reporter]]}}</ref> His debut [[young adult novel]], ''The Magic Misfits'', was released in November 2017 and is the first in a four-book series.<ref>{{Cite web|url=https://www.hachettebookgroup.com/_b2c/media/files/14-10-2015/2015-10-07_ACQ_Neil_Patrick_Harris.pdf|title=Little, Brown Books for Young Readers to Publish Neil Patrick Harris's Debut Middle Grade Series—The Magic Misfits|last=Shoffel|first=Jessica|date=October 7, 2015|website=[[Hachette Book Group]]|publisher=[[Little, Brown and Company]]|access-date=January 25, 2017|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20151123143225/http://www.hachettebookgroup.com/_b2c/media/files/14-10-2015/2015-10-07_ACQ_Neil_Patrick_Harris.pdf|archive-date=November 23, 2015|url-status=dead}}</ref><ref>{{Cite book|title=The Magic Misfits|last=Harris|first=Neil Patrick|date=September 19, 2017|publisher=[[Little, Brown Books for Young Readers]]|isbn=9780316391825|location=S.l.}}</ref><ref>{{cite news|last1=Roberts|first1=M.B.|title=Neil Patrick Harris Talks Practical Magic for Kids, Holiday Traditions and More|url=https://parade.com/621662/m-b-roberts/neil-patrick-harris-talks-practical-magic-for-kids-holiday-traditions-and-more/|newspaper=Parade: Entertainment, Recipes, Health, Life, Holidays|publisher=AMG/Parade|access-date=November 21, 2017|date=November 20, 2017|archive-date=November 21, 2017|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20171121024110/https://parade.com/621662/m-b-roberts/neil-patrick-harris-talks-practical-magic-for-kids-holiday-traditions-and-more/|url-status=live}}</ref> In October 2020, Harris released a single-player board game named ''Box One'', produced by Theory11. As of February 2021, it is available exclusively through [[Target Corporation|Target]].<ref>{{Cite web|url=https://www.cnet.com/deals/i-played-the-30-tabletop-escape-game-box-one-this-weekend-its-totally-worth-it/|title=I played the $30 tabletop escape game Box One this weekend. It's totally worth it|work=[[CNET]]|date=February 8, 2021|access-date=May 13, 2025|archive-date=September 5, 2022|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20220905194536/https://www.cnet.com/deals/i-played-the-30-tabletop-escape-game-box-one-this-weekend-its-totally-worth-it/|url-status=live}}</ref> Harris has been a frequent guest narrator at [[Disney's Candlelight Processional]] at [[Walt Disney World]].<ref>{{cite web|url=https://www.floridatoday.com/story/news/local/2024/10/17/epcot-candlelight-processional-josh-gad-whoopi-celebs-neil-patrick-harris-christmas/75714642007/|title=Neil Patrick Harris, Whoopi Goldberg, Josh Gad, to narrate Christmas story at EPCOT|work=[[Florida Today]]|date=October 17, 2024|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20241101140131/https://www.floridatoday.com/story/news/local/2024/10/17/epcot-candlelight-processional-josh-gad-whoopi-celebs-neil-patrick-harris-christmas/75714642007/|archive-date=November 1, 2024|access-date=May 7, 2025|url-status=live}}</ref> In January 2021, Harris starred in the British drama series ''[[It's a Sin (TV series)|It's a Sin]]'', broadcast on [[Channel 4]] and [[HBO Max]], depicting the [[HIV/AIDS in the United Kingdom|1980s HIV/AIDS epidemic]] in the United Kingdom.<ref>{{Cite news |date=January 26, 2021 |title=Meet the cast of Channel 4 drama It's A Sin |language=en |work=[[Radio Times]] |url=https://www.radiotimes.com/tv/drama/its-a-sin-cast/ |access-date=February 3, 2021 |archive-date=February 6, 2021 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20210206040426/https://www.radiotimes.com/tv/drama/its-a-sin-cast/ |url-status=live }}</ref> In June 2021, he was announced to be a judge on ''[[Australia's Got Talent: Challengers & Champions]]'', a spin-off series of ''[[Australia's Got Talent]]''.<ref>{{cite web|first=David|last=Knox|url=https://tvtonight.com.au/2021/06/neil-patrick-harris-to-judge-australias-got-talent.html|title=Neil Patrick Harris to judge Australia's Got Talent|date=June 13, 2021|work=[[TV Tonight]]|accessdate=June 13, 2021|archive-date=June 13, 2021|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20210613004545/https://tvtonight.com.au/2021/06/neil-patrick-harris-to-judge-australias-got-talent.html|url-status=live}}</ref><ref>{{cite web|first=Bianca|last=Mastroianni|url=https://www.news.com.au/entertainment/tv/reality-tv/neil-patrick-harris-announced-as-an-australias-got-talent-judge-alongside-kate-richie-shane-jacobson-and-alesha-dixon/news-story/053778e600a900c6edf8aa88929a0c0c|title=Neil Patrick Harris announced as an Australia's Got Talent judge alongside Kate Richie, Shane Jacobson and Alesha Dixon|date=June 13, 2021|work=[[News.com.au]]|accessdate=June 13, 2021}}</ref> Harris appeared in ''[[The Matrix Resurrections]]'', the fourth installment of [[The Matrix (franchise)|the ''Matrix'' franchise]], released in December 2021.<ref>{{cite web | url=https://variety.com/2019/film/news/matrix-4-neil-patrick-harris-1203371790/ | title='Matrix 4': Neil Patrick Harris Lands Role in Latest Installment | first=Justin | last=Kroll | date=October 15, 2019 | access-date=October 15, 2019 | work=[[Variety (magazine)|Variety]] | publisher=[[Penske Media Corporation]] | archive-date=December 14, 2019 | arch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20191214140501/https://variety.com/2019/film/news/matrix-4-neil-patrick-harris-1203371790/ | url-status=live }}</ref> In 2022, he joined the [[Encores!]] presentation of [[Stephen Sondheim]]'s ''[[Into the Woods]]'' as The Baker; the limited production ran at the [[New York City Center]] from May 4 to 15.<ref>{{cite web|url= https://playbill.com/article/see-cast-of-encores-into-the-woods-celebrate-new-york-city-centers-spring-gala|title= See Cast of Encores! Into the Woods Celebrate New York City Center's Spring Gala|website= [[Playbill]]|accessdate= June 30, 2022|archive-date= June 30, 2022|archive-url= https://web.archive.org/web/20220630191700/https://playbill.com/article/see-cast-of-encores-into-the-woods-celebrate-new-york-city-centers-spring-gala|url-status= live}}</ref> Harris also starred in the 2022 Netflix series ''[[Uncoupled]]'' as [[LGBTQ culture in New York City|gay Manhattanite]] Michael Lawson, a [[realtor]] re-navigating the dating scene after 17 years.<ref>{{Cite news |date=July 29, 2022 |title=Neil Patrick Harris's 'Uncoupled' is a joyless look at starting over |newspaper=[[The Washington Post]] |url=https://www.washingtonpost.com/tv/2022/07/29/uncoupled-neil-patrick-harris-review/ |access-date=August 25, 2022 |archive-date=September 14, 2022 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20220914223057/https://www.washingtonpost.com/tv/2022/07/29/uncoupled-neil-patrick-harris-review/ |url-status=live }}</ref> He also portrayed Francis Beaumont in ''[[Peter Pan Goes Wrong]]'' for a limited engagement from April 11 to May 7, 2023.<ref>{{Cite web |url=https://www.broadwayworld.com/article/Neil-Patrick-Harris-Extends-Run-in-PETER-PAN-GOES-WRONG-Through-Early-May-20230424 |title=Neil Patrick Harris Extends Run in PETER PAN GOES WRONG Through Early May |access-date=April 24, 2023 |archive-date=April 24, 2023 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20230424203733/https://www.broadwayworld.com/article/Neil-Patrick-Harris-Extends-Run-in-PETER-PAN-GOES-WRONG-Through-Early-May-20230424 |url-status=live }}</ref> In December 2023, Harris guest starred as the [[The Celestial Toymaker|Toymaker]] in the third and final special, "[[The Giggle]]", of the [[Doctor Who specials (2023)|60th anniversary specials]] of ''[[Doctor Who]]''.<ref>{{Cite web |title=Watch new Doctor Who trailer for 60th Anniversary Specials |url=https://www.bbc.co.uk/mediacentre/2023/doctor-who-new-trailer-60th-anniversary-specials/ |access-date=September 23, 2023 |publisher=[[BBC]] |archive-date=September 24, 2023 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20230924010108/https://www.bbc.co.uk/mediacentre/2023/doctor-who-new-trailer-60th-anniversary-specials |url-status=live }}</ref><ref>{{cite news |last1=Haring |first1=Bruce |date=September 23, 2023 |title='Doctor Who' Unveils 60th Anniversary Specials Trailer With Neil Patrick-Harris |work=[[Deadline Hollywood]] |publisher=[[Penske Media Corporation]] |url=https://deadline.com/2023/09/doctor-who-unveils-60th-anniversary-specials-trailer-neil-patrick-harris-1235554393/ |archive-date=September 23, 2023 |access-date=September 23, 2023 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20230923184611/https://deadline.com/2023/09/doctor-who-unveils-60th-anniversary-specials-trailer-neil-patrick-harris-1235554393/ |url-status=live }}</ref>
